Abstract

A method, apparatus, and computer-readable media comprise receiving a broadcast digital television signal comprising data relevant to one or more particular locations; generating a pseudorange based on the broadcast digital television signal; and determining location of an apparatus based on the pseudorange and a location of a transmitter of the broadcast digital television signal, and selecting a portion of the data relevant to the one or more particular locations based on the determined location of the apparatus.

Claims (87)

1. An apparatus comprising:

a receiver adapted to receive a broadcast digital television signal comprising data relevant to one or more particular locations;

a pseudorange unit adapted to generate a pseudorange based on the broadcast digital television signal; and

a processor adapted to

determine the location of the apparatus based on the pseudorange and a location of a transmitter of the broadcast digital television signal, and

select a portion of the data relevant to the one or more particular locations based on the location of the apparatus determined by the processor.

2. The ap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ising:

an output device adapted to output the data selected by the processor.

3. The ap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the output device is selected from the group consisting of:

a display; and

a speaker.

4. The ap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ising:

a signal generator adapted to generate a correlation reference signal based on known characteristics of the broadcast digital television signal; and

a correlator adapted to correlate the broadcast digital television signal with the correlation reference signal, thereby producing the pseudorange.

5.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the processor is further adapted to:

adjust the pseudorange based on a difference between a transmitter clock at the transmitter of the broadcast digital television signal and a known time reference; and

determine the location of the apparatus based on the pseudorange adjusted by the processor and the location of the transmitter of the broadcast digital television signal.

6. The ap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ising:

a time-gated delay-lock loop to track the broadcast digital television signal.

7.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the data relevant to one or more particular locations is selected from the group consisting of:

traffic information for the one or more particular locations;

emergency information for the one or more particular locations;

weather information for the one or more particular locations;

maps of the one or more particular locations; and

businesses in the one or more particular locations.
